What’s for Dinner?

Since we dropped the cake off last night, we didn’t use our certificate gifts but went instead to a great gourmet place in Utica, Perugia’s.  The waiter was this guy we see literally, EVERYWHERE! We used to see him at the gym when we went to Planet Fitness. He has waited on us in 3 different restaurants, now add Perugia as a 4th.  We see him working in the bakery of Price Chopper. First thing I said to him is “We couldn’t get away from you if we tried!”.  He’s a good guy and provided great service with lots of attention.  Anyway….carrot-cake-005  dinner was phenomenal.   We began with a rustic bread assortment. Had a good green salad.  I had the Pan Seared Ahi Tuna with Saki, Soy and Ginger Glaze.  It was served on top of a Risotto Cake (delish!) and shredded sauteed Napa Cabbage. The wasabi made my eyes water and I don’t like that. Give me a nice hot pepper any day over hot wasabi.  Ted is the reverse. He enjoys wasabi but doesn’t like hot peppers.   Speaking of which, Ted had the Shrimp Ravioli served in a grand, light cream sauce. I tasted just a bit and it was beautiful.   Here are the shots to tempt your buds.
